Abstract

Project summary The National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ases, National Institute of Health, has established 11 international centers of excellence in malaria research (ICEMR). This administrative supplement seeks funding for the Ethiopian ICEMR center to host the annual workshop for the 11 centers and scientific advisory group (SAG) meeting for Ethiopia and Uganda ICEMRs in Addis Ababa, Ethiopia. We will manage the scientific program of the workshop, and facilitate the travel logistics of participants from all 11 ICEMR centers. The 5-day workshop and SAG meeting will include presentations by individual ICEMRs on their scientific progress, information sessions on the ICEMR program specific requirement, discussion sessions on common issues of interest and break-out sessions on specific important scientific questions in malaria research and control. The workshop will enable participants to share their latest discoveries, expertise, experience, lessons, resources and protocols, and identify areas of inter-center collaboration The SAG meeting will offer each ICEMR the chance to present their progress to the SAG members, who will, in turn, provide critical feedback and recommendations. Malaria is a very significant public health problem. The workshop contributes to the malaria research and control efforts by facilitating data sharing and collaboration among malaria researchers from different centers and regions, and subsequently enhancing the development of new malaria diagnosis and control tools and strategies.
